From d5c6a58ff921d1bc85e696bda6c7976007236b93 Mon Sep 17 00:00:00 2001 From: "sweep-ai[bot]" <128439645+sweep-ai[bot]@users.noreply.github.com> Date: Mon, 26 Jun 2023 19:43:55 +0000 Subject: [PATCH 1/3] sweep: "Add unit tests for devise_security_extension" --- test/devise_security_extension_test.rb | 19 +++++++++++++++++++ 1 file changed, 19 insertions(+) create mode 100644 test/devise_security_extension_test.rb diff --git a/test/devise_security_extension_test.rb b/test/devise_security_extension_test.rb new file mode 100644 index 00000000..b8951b9f --- /dev/null +++ b/test/devise_security_extension_test.rb @@ -0,0 +1,19 @@ +require 'test/unit' +require 'devise_security_extension' +class DeviseSecurityExtensionTest < Test::Unit::TestCase + def setup + # setup code goes here + end + def teardown + # cleanup code goes here + end + def test_functionality_1 + # test code for functionality 1 goes here + end + def test_functionality_2 + # test code for functionality 2 goes here + end + # more test cases as needed +end + + From 691712629a9365f4e9fa0b32b2768d1821e043e9 Mon Sep 17 00:00:00 2001 From: "sweep-ai[bot]" <128439645+sweep-ai[bot]@users.noreply.github.com> Date: Mon, 26 Jun 2023 19:46:40 +0000 Subject: [PATCH 2/3] Update test/test_devise_security_extension.rb --- test/test_devise_security_extension.rb | 12 +++++++++++- 1 file changed, 11 insertions(+), 1 deletion(-) diff --git a/test/test_devise_security_extension.rb b/test/test_devise_security_extension.rb index d9e80dae..00f38961 100644 --- a/test/test_devise_security_extension.rb +++ b/test/test_devise_security_extension.rb @@ -1,7 +1,17 @@ require 'helper' - class TestDeviseSecurityExtension < Test::Unit::TestCase def test_something_for_real flunk "hey buddy, you should probably rename this file and start testing for real" end + def test_functionality_1 + # setup for functionality 1 + # call functionality 1 + # assert the expected result of functionality 1 + end + def test_functionality_2 + # setup for functionality 2 + # call functionality 2 + # assert the expected result of functionality 2 + end + # more test cases as needed end From 5c338f9cb38f71aa3dce65a59677e6f9fe770745 Mon Sep 17 00:00:00 2001 From: "sweep-ai[bot]" <128439645+sweep-ai[bot]@users.noreply.github.com> Date: Mon, 26 Jun 2023 19:47:55 +0000 Subject: [PATCH 3/3] Update test/helper.rb --- test/helper.rb |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/test/helper.rb b/test/helper.rb index e9581f1e..9685dc17 100644 --- a/test/helper.rb +++ b/test/helper.rb @@ -8,10 +8,11 @@ exit e.status_code end require 'test/unit' - $LOAD_PATH.unshift(File.dirname(__FILE__)) $LOAD_PATH.unshift(File.join(File.dirname(__FILE__), '..', 'lib')) -require 'devise_security_extension' - +# require any other necessary files for the tests +# require 'file_name' class Test::Unit::TestCase + # add any necessary setup for the test environment + # setup code goes here end